A Smart AI Framework for Construction Compliance, Quality Assurance, and Risk Management in Housing Projects

Abstract

The construction industry, particularly in housing projects, faces numerous challenges, including ensuring regulatory compliance, maintaining high-quality standards, and managing risks such as delays, cost overruns, and safety concerns. This paper explores the integration of Artificial Intelligence (AI) into construction to address these issues through a smart, AI-driven framework for compliance, quality assurance, and risk management. By reviewing existing literature on AI applications in construction, the paper highlights how AI technologies, such as predictive analytics, natural language processing, and machine learning, can significantly improve construction outcomes by streamlining compliance processes, enhancing quality control, and mitigating risks in real-time. The paper also discusses the key design principles for creating an AI framework tailored to construction, examining how AI can monitor regulatory adherence, ensure quality standards, and predict potential project risks. While AI presents vast opportunities, the paper identifies challenges such as technological integration, financial constraints, and regulatory hurdles that may hinder its widespread adoption. Proposed solutions, including AI-based decision-support tools and cloud-based platforms, aim to overcome these challenges. Finally, the paper emphasizes the need for future research, particularly in areas like the integration of AI with Building Information Modeling (BIM), the development of universal standards for AI in construction, and the validation of AI frameworks through case studies. This research provides valuable insights into the potential of AI to transform the construction industry, offering recommendations for further development and implementation in housing projects.
